When considering an affordable master's degree, it's essential to understand what qualifies as 'affordable'. In our system, any master’s programme with tuition fees ranging from 0 to 2,500 euros per year is considered affordable. This range makes it accessible for many international students, especially those looking for budget-friendly options. In Pakistan, affordable master's programmes can start from €0, meaning some universities offer tuition-free education. This makes Pakistan an appealing destination for students searching for cheap master's degrees. Geo-environmental Conservation and Sustainable Development (GCSD)
Geo-environmental Conservation and Sustainable Development (GCSD) from University of the Punjab is based the combination of course work and research. To obtain the degree, a student must complete 24 credit hours of course work for MPhil along with a minimum of 6 credit hours for research work/thesis.

Civil Engineering
The MS in Civil Engineering at COMSATS University Islamabad is a two year graduate program after BS Engineering. The program spans over 4 semesters with a minimum requirement of 30 credit hours. There is a research project in the last semester of the program in which the students apply their learning in consolidation.

To qualify for a Masters in Pakistan, you typically need a relevant bachelor's degree with a minimum GPA of 2.5 out of 4.0 or equivalent. Some programmes may require specific prerequisite courses or professional experience. Additionally, international students must provide proof of English proficiency through tests like IELTS or TOEFL. The application process usually involves submitting transcripts, a statement of purpose, and letters of recommendation. For cheap master's degrees in Pakistan, most universities require proof of English proficiency. This is typically demonstrated through standardised tests like IELTS or TOEFL. Minimum score requirements vary by institution but generally fall within the range of 6.0 to 6.5 for IELTS and 79 to 85 for TOEFL. Some universities may also accept other recognised English language tests. It's important to check the specific requirements of the programme you are interested in to ensure you meet the language criteria.

While tuition fees for affordable master's programmes in Pakistan are low, there are additional costs to consider. These include living expenses such as accommodation, food, and transportation. On average, international students can expect to spend between €300 to €500 per month on living costs. Other expenses may include textbooks, supplies, and health insurance. It's advisable to create a budget that accounts for these additional costs to ensure a smooth study experience in Pakistan.
